apologies if this has already been talked about but does anyone use a good end of day charting package for us stocks. my trading technique doesn't require thousands of different indicators or a live feed so a simple package or web site would do the trick. A scroll through function of a set list of stocks, similar to sharescope's, would be really handy. thanks in advance.

snoball - 10 Aug 2004 00:08 - 2138 of 2279

Eric, try stockcharts.com.
Not only does it have the usual US stocks but also the Indeces plus some indicators of their own devising like the Bullish Percent link here. A very useful site. It's free too.
